Next time I need to change my chainring, I might look at something a little smaller than the 50T I currently have.
Tried the 44T in the past and it wasn't right. So looking at a 46 or 48 if I can find the right thing.
Why? After almost a year and a half of not using my Brompton, I was in at work for a week last week and noticed how much my cadence has changed since riding a road bike in that time. Whereas I was quite happy in the past sitting in 5th a 70rpm, I've been more used to 90rpm on my other bikes.
Changing down to 4th at the same speed meant my legs were going too fast for the Brompton as it bobs a bit, so I'd like to up the cadence (a bit) so that 5th at +/- 16mph is more comfortable. I was thinking of a 48t as it wouldn't change things too drastically.
Anyone done it? Can you recommend a particular chainring? Or is is a case of any old 5 arm PCD130 will fit?
